More Information about Power Play

Nestled in the heart of Southland, Power Play stands as a beacon for music enthusiasts from all walks of life. Since our humble beginning, we've dedicated ourselves to the art and soul of musical instruments, fostering a deep-rooted passion that transcends the notes on a page. Our journey began with a simple aspiration: to create an inclusive space where musicians could find their rhythm, perfect their craft, and connect with like-minded souls who share the same zest for music. Over the years, we've grown from a small storefront into a comprehensive musical haven, offering top-tier sales, expert repairs, and exceptional music tuition services. As you step into our doors, you're greeted by a symphony of sounds, the sweet scent of new wood, and walls adorned with instruments that bear the stories of countless musicians who have graced them. Our inventory spans from the strings of a violin to the keys of a piano, the drums of a marching band, and everything in between - each instrument meticulously handpicked for quality and craftsmanship.
